Runbook: soft deletes, Cartwheel orders table. Deletes set a tombstone flag; rows are never dropped inline. Purge job runs nightly, removes tombstoned rows past retention. Security notes: tombstoned rows remain queryable by the reporting role — verify this is acceptable. Audit log records actor and reason on every soft delete. Restores require two-person approval. The purge job and retention behavior are governed by the service configuration shown below.

settings of kajep-kawip:
[zorys]
host = zorys.urlaqgrid.corp
user = zorys_svc
database = zorys_prod

# Build Provenance: Wirecrest Gateway Compression

The Wirecrest gateway ships with permessage-deflate disabled by default. Enabling it cuts bandwidth roughly 40% on dashboard frames but introduces compression-context memory per connection and a known oracle risk when attacker-controlled data shares frames with secrets. Builds that enable it are flagged in the provenance manifest. Reviewers should confirm the flag against the attestation token recorded below.

trace token, fafog-kageg: htk4_98e6

### Shard the profile store

Applies to Pellwick's user-profile store (grovedb cluster). Freeze writes via the admin toggle first. Run the shard planner; it emits a split map. Verify row counts per shard are within 5% of each other before proceeding. Apply the split map during the low-traffic window only. Replicas rejoin automatically after rebalance. Do not skip the checksum pass. Once rebalance completes, restart each node with the following values.

service settings:
ralwyn:
  log_level: error
  metrics_host: metrics.ralwyn.tolvaqsys.internal
  pin: 9545
  pool_size: 8

Subject: Cursor pagination live in Lanternfeed API v4

Team, the public REST API now uses cursor-based pagination on all list endpoints. Offset parameters still work but are deprecated and return a warning header. Point customers to the updated docs when they report missing pages. Default page size is now 50. The build that shipped this is below.

pipeline stamp: htk9_ce63042d9